I updated the firmware on my RUT360 to the latest version R_00.07.02.4 from R_00.07.02. The router now won't load the web UI after logon - it just says loading and constantly flashes the three mobile signal lights.

I've had a quick browse of the forum and tried some of the suggestions including the following:

1. Downgrade the firmware back to R_00.07.02 via SSH

2. Use the bootloader mode to flash the firmware back to a legacy version in this case R-00.02.06 - this allowed me to access the old web UI from which I re-flashed the firmware to R_00.07.02.4 with the keep settings button disabled.

Neither of these fixed the issue I still have a broken web ui and the three lights flash constantly.

When I run the logread command I get the following:

Sun Sep  4 19:08:00 2022 daemon.err mdcollectd: SQLite error: source and destination must be distinct
Sun Sep  4 19:08:00 2022 daemon.err mdcollectd: Error while doing database backup
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 kern.notice Authentication was successful from HTTP 172.16.1.107
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err uhttpd[3105]: vuci: accepted login for admin from 172.16.1.107
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: /usr/bin/lua: /usr/lib/lua/ubus/ui.lua:653: attempt to index local 'boardInfo' (a nil value)
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: stack traceback:
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: /usr/lib/lua/ubus/ui.lua:653: in function 'generate_dynamic_routes'
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: /usr/lib/lua/ubus/ui.lua:749: in function 'get_menus'
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: /usr/lib/lua/ubus/ui.lua:955: in function </usr/lib/lua/ubus/ui.lua:949>
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: [C]: in function 'run'
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: /usr/sbin/vuci:98: in function 'main'
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: /usr/sbin/vuci:101: in main chunk
Sun Sep  4 19:09:09 2022 daemon.err vuci[7625]: [C]: ?

Is there anything else I can try?

Hello,

I would like you to provide more details about your device. Before attempting a firmware update, what was the device configuration? Have you made any mobile configuration changes, was remote access enabled, anything else other than default settings?

Could you connect to the device via command line or SSH and post the output of the following command: 

  • hexdump -C /dev/mtd1

Another thing you could do is to execute the command troubleshoot.sh in the command line. This would generate a log file in your device located in /tmp directory called similarly to troubleshoot.tar.gz. I would like you to copy this file using WinSCP to your PC (follow instructions provided here) and attach that file by editing your question.
